2 Big Players Consider Field Buyout Firms Usually Shun
Article Abstract:
Private equity firms Thomas H. Lee Partners and the Texas Pacific Group are considering buying out all or part of financial services company, Fidelity National Financial Inc. in a deal that could be worth as much as $9 billion.

Don't Believe the Hype. A Hip-Hop Mogul Says It's Propaganda
Article Abstract:
Record executive Russell Simmons, who also founded the clothing line Phat Farm, admitted to lying about the apparel company's profits shortly before it was bought by the Kellwood Company for $140 million.

Swiss holding firm acquires Meridian
Article Abstract:
The Estatia AG, Swiss holding company, is buying Toronto-based Meridian Technologies Inc. for $200-million in cash. Meridian is the world's largest magnesium die-casting company based in Toronto.
